Family Dynamics

Understanding Roles, Boundaries, and Patterns That Shape Us

Why do the same conflicts seem to repeat across generations? Why do certain relationships leave you feeling stuck, responsible for everyone else, or disconnected from yourself? This certificate program brings the powerful insights of Family Systems Theory out of graduate school and into everyday life, blending Bowen Family Systems Theory, Structural Family Therapy,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), and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) into practical tools you can immediately apply. Whether you're seeking personal growth or supporting others professionally, you'll begin to see the hidden "architecture" behind relationships—and learn how changing one part of the system can transform the whole.

What you'll learn

Skills and shifts you can expect

By the end of this certificate program, you'll be able to:

Recognize family roles, invisible rules, and relationship patterns that influence behavior.
Understand how boundaries, emotional triggers, and communication patterns develop within family systems.
Identify intergenerational patterns and begin breaking cycles that no longer serve you.
Apply practical concepts from Bowen Family Systems Theory and Structural Family Therapy to everyday relationships.
Strengthen self-awareness while responding to conflict with greater clarity and intention.
Use evidence-based tools from CBT and DBT to support healthier communication and emotional regulation.
Understand how the same systems principles apply not only to families, but also to teams, workplaces, and communities.
